  • Investment Analyst

    The interview at Invesco was thorough, focusing on my understanding of various investment strategies, financial modeling, and quantitative analysis. They asked questions about my experience with equity, fixed income, and alternative investments.

    Questions asked during the interview:

    1. How do you approach asset allocation for different types of clients?
    2. Can you explain your experience with financial modeling techniques such as DCF and comparable company analysis?
    3. How do you measure portfolio performance and assess the risk-adjusted return?
    4. What statistical models have you used for predictive analytics in the investment space?
    5. Can you walk us through a scenario where you identified an underperforming investment and how you adjusted the portfolio accordingly?
  • Investment Analyst

    The interview process at NextGen Venture Partners was insightful and engaging. The team asked thoughtful questions about my experience with early-stage investment, due diligence, and deal structuring. They were professional and provided a great understanding of their investment philosophy.
    Questions asked during the interview:

    1. How do you approach identifying promising early-stage startups?
    2. Can you walk us through your due diligence process for evaluating a potential investment?
    3. What factors do you consider when structuring a deal with a startup?
    4. How do you build and leverage your professional network to discover investment opportunities?
    5. What methods do you use to assess a startup’s growth potential and scalability?
    6. How do you stay updated on emerging trends in the venture capital space?
